About Florian Reichart

Florian Reichart is a scholar working on Immunology and Allergy, Equine and Oncology, having authored 24 papers that have together received 1.1k indexed citations. Recurring topics across this work include Cell Adhesion Molecules Research (13 papers), Chemical Synthesis and Analysis (4 papers) and Peptidase Inhibition and Analysis (4 papers). The work is most often cited by research in Immunology and Allergy (257 citations), Microbiology (98 citations) and Biomaterials (142 citations). Florian Reichart has collaborated with scholars based in Germany, Italy and India. Frequent co-authors include Horst Kessler, Michael Weinmüller, Andreas F. B. Räder, Hans‐Jürgen Wester, Johannes Notni, Ute Reuning, Markus Nieberler, Katja Steiger, Markus Schwaiger and Chaim Gilon. Their work appears in journals such as Angewandte Chemie International Edition, Nano Letters and Biomaterials.
